Post-NAIC Update/PBA Webinar
October 26, 2010
Noon - 1:30 p.m. Eastern
Register now for the Life Practice Council's Oct. 26 webinar to review the principle-based reserves project, as discussed at the NAIC Fall National Meeting in Orlando. The 90-minute offering also will include a presentation on credibility theory related to mortality and an example of building the mortality assumption.
